Relive the impact he has had on a whole generation across the world.His LifeMichael Joseph Jackson (August 29th 1958 – June 25th 2009) was an American recording artist, and unrivalled entertainer. The seventh child of the Jackson family, he made his debut on the professional music scene in 1968 as a member of the Jackson5. He began his solo career in 1971 and Jackson's 1982 album “Thriller” remains the world's best selling album of all time and four of his other solo studio albums are among the world's best selling records – “Off the Wall” (1979), Bad (1987), “Dangerous” (1991) and “HIStory” (1995).One of the few artists to have been inducted into the “Rock and Roll Hall of Fame” twice, his other achievements include multiple “Guinness World Records” — including one for 'Most Successful Entertainer of All Time' — 13 “Grammy Awards”, 13 “number one singles” in his solo career, and the sale of 750 million records worldwide.This collection of top news reports, reproduced from the original newspapers, records all these moments, written as they happened.
